Cambridge launches driverless electric shuttle buses

The first driverless electric shuttle buses hit the roads in the city of Cambridge in the UK yesterday as part of ground-breaking trials. Cambridge driverless electric shuttle buses The Aurrigo Auto-Shuttle will operate on a two-mile route between Madingley park and ride…

Ford F-150 Lightning’s 300-mile range is with 1,000 lbs of cargo, actual range could be over 400 miles

The Ford F-150 Lightning might have a longer range than expected and could even present a new way of advertising range in electric trucks. When Ford unveiled the F-150 Lightning, the automaker’s new electric version of its best-selling pickup truck, the company announced two battery pack options with 230 miles and 300 miles of range.
